                  My arguement isnt what Whitner is worth, but rather what is the picks in question worth?

                  Is there some real tangible difference between a 11 pick and a 20 pick? Yes, they get paid more. Do we care? Especially now when we are keeping this team way under the cap.

                  The typical rankings of players seem to be based on a individual overall ranking. That ranking would then allow someone to "stack" players from best rank to worst.

                  However, the concept of "reach" seems to tell us that we are overspending or overinvesting in a prospect.

                  But, isnt the needs of each team also a major determinant in who gets taken when? If so, the concept of reach, may be reduced.

                  I just dont see it. I would look at players as having a general range. That range is based on need of the teams and where they pick. If a team like sthe Bills is desperate for a WR, and the WR's rank in the 15-25 range, but they pick at 11, I think all bets are off.

                  Needs drives the market, more so than worth at times.

                  Several WR's, including Sweed, Thomas, and Kelly look to have a 15-25 rank. But if the Bills took one at 11, its because need drove the pick.

                  I would not see that as a reach IMO
